Monkeypox virus is transmitted from one person to another by close contact with lesions, body fluids, respiratory droplets and contaminated materials such as bedding.Monkeypox is transmitted to humans through close contact with an infected person or animal, or with material contaminated with the virus.In recent times, the case fatality ratio has been around 3–6%.
Monkeypox is usually a self-limited disease with the symptoms lasting from 2 to 4 weeks.Monkeypox is caused by monkeypox virus, a member of the Orthopoxvirus genus in the family Poxviridae.
Newer vaccines have been developed of which one has been approved for prevention of monkeypox
